The easiest way to embed HTML5 project into your web page is using an iframe (inline frame). Iframe is just a very simple HTML code that used to display content from another source into a web page. If you know copy and paste, you can do it. The src attribute specifies the URL (web address) of the inline frame page.
How to Add HTML Embed Code to Your Site Go to the social post or webpage you'd like to embed. Generate the embed code using the post's options. If applicable, customize the embed post, such as the height and width of the element. Highlight the embed code, then copy it to your clipboard.
To insert an embed code, simply copy it to your computer's clipboard (by choosing Edit→Copy), go to your website's content management system, and then paste the code (by choosing Edit→Paste) into the correct spot in your web page.
